What does an User Experience Designer/Developer IV Do?

The User Experience Designer/Developer IV handles projects from conceptualization through delivery. Designs web pages and develops web-based technical solutions that engage users and meet business requirements. Being an User Experience Designer/Developer IV designs and develops the web infrastructure including back-end database development and the construction of SQL queries via CGI scripting. Develops and applies creative designs, ensuring that content meets brand standards and targets the intended audience. In addition, User Experience Designer/Developer IV tests and improves site usability ... while ensuring optimal performance on a variety of browsers. Requires knowledge of web technologies and tools such as HTML, Shockwave, Photoshop, Illustrator, Adobe Flex, Adobe Flash, JavaScript, CSS, Ruby, Python, PERL, PHP, Active Server Pages, and C++. Typically requires a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. Being an User Experience Designer/Developer IV work is highly independent. May assume a team lead role for the work group. A specialist on complex technical and business matters. Working as an User Experience Designer/Developer IV typically requires 7+ years of related experience. More
